“Why I Abandoned Music” — J. Martins


Nigerian musician, Martins Okechukwu Justice, popularly known as J. Martins, has revealed why he quit music after being absent from the music scene for years.

It would be recalled that Martins had his big break in the music industry back in 2008 with his hit track “cool temper.”

 After that he went on to feature P-Square in “E No Easy” and also collaborated with several A-listers before suddenly going MIA in the entertainment industry. 

 Speaking to Punch on why he left music, the singer said he wanted to improve his knowledge in other things, as music is not the only passion he has. 

“I stayed off music for a while because I had to upgrade my knowledge and some other aspects of my life. 

 “Music is not the only thing that makes me happy, neither is it the only knowledge I like to have. 

 “I had the opportunity to upgrade my knowledge and I had to give attention to it. That was why much was not seen of me on the music scene. However, I am back in full force. “When the COVID-19 pandemic happened, I had to come back home. I am now ready to work with Nigerian artistes, especially the younger ones whom I like.


 “Aside from music, I am also involved in agriculture, as well as being an activist (advocate) for good governance. There are other businesses I do too because I believe one is supposed to have multiple streams of income,” J. Martins said.
